Variability regions for the third derivative of bounded analytic functions

Complex Variables 2020-05-18 v1

Abstract

Let z0z_0 and w0w_0 be given points in the open unit disk D\mathbb{D} with w0<z0|w_0| < |z_0|, and H0\mathcal{H}_0 be the class of all analytic self-maps ff of D\mathbb{D} normalized by f(0)=0f(0)=0. In this paper, we establish the third order Dieudonn\'e Lemma, and apply it to explicitly determine the variability region {f(z0):fH0,f(z0)=w0,f(z0)=w1}\{f'''(z_0): f\in \mathcal{H}_0,f(z_0) =w_0, f'(z_0)=w_1\} for given z0,w0,w1z_0,w_0,w_1 and give the form of all the extremal functions.
